ALLENSON, Violet Passed away peacefully on Saturday, January 30, 2010 in the evening with her husband John and her children by her side. Violet was met by her son, Paul (1974) and her daughter, Jennifer (1996) as she went home. She will be remembered by her children Larry Allenson, Donna Mae Heer (Barry), Charlene Crozier and Nancy Ann Reidel, all of Kitchener, Lorna Allenson of Clifton, Lisa Shantz-Connell (Doug) of Nova Scotia and David Allenson (Colleen) of Roseville. Loving grandmother of 13 grandchildren and 15 great-grandchildren. Dear sister of Robert of St. Catherines, Bernice of Thessalon and Leona (Stan) of Harriston. Sister-in-law of Sandi of Hepworth, Loreen of Hanover, Verna of Neustadt, and Mary Jean of Kitchener. Violet was a member of the Ladies Auxillary of the Royal Canadian Legion Branch 530, Waterloo for over 50 years. Long time treasurer of S.O.A.R. Local #80 Retiree Club, Rockway Seniors' Centre and the Cape Breton Club. Long time active member of St. Stephen's Lutheran Church. Relatives and friends are invited to call at the Schreiter-Sandrock Funeral Home and Chapel (51 Benton at Church Street, Kitchener) on Tuesday from 7-9 p.m. and Wednesday from 2-4 and 7-9 p.m. Transfer will be made at 12 noon on Thursday, February 4, 2010 to St. Stephen's Lutheran Church (248 Highland Road East, Kitchener) for a complete funeral at 1:00 p.m. Pastor William Shafer officiating. Reception to follow in the church hall. Interment will take place at Memory Gardens Cemetery, Breslau. Violet was dearly loved and will be sadly missed by all. Donations to St. Stephen's Lutheran Church Building Fund, or to the Royal Canadian Legion Branch 530 Ladies Auxillary would be appreciated. For online condolences please visit www.mem.com
